Split fatty acids from tall oil are fractionally distilled to separate low-rosin fatty acids for dimerization in polyamide resins. HTS 3823.13.0040 covers this 'other' category of industrial tall oil fatty acids used in adhesives and inks. Derived from kraft pulp mill tall oil refining processes.
